Ingredients for a Classic Margarita
To craft a perfect margarita for two servings, gather these high-quality ingredients:
- 4 oz tequila (blanco for a crisp taste or reposado for smoothness)
- 2 oz lime juice (freshly squeezed for optimal flavor)
- 2 oz triple sec (Cointreau or Grand Marnier recommended)
- 1 oz simple syrup (adjust for desired sweetness)
- Kosher salt or chili salt for the rim
- Lime wedges for garnish
- Ice cubes (for shaking and serving)
- Optional: Mango puree for a tropical variation

Step-by-Step Instructions for a Classic Margarita
Follow these easy steps to create a refreshing margarita:
Step 1: Prepare the Glass
Rub a lime wedge around the rim of a margarita glass to moisten it.

Dip the rim into a small plate with kosher salt or chili salt for a spicy twist.
Set the glass aside to dry while you prepare the drink.

Step 2: Mix the Cocktail
Fill a cocktail shaker with ice cubes.

Add 4 oz tequila, 2 oz lime juice, 2 oz triple sec, and 1 oz simple syrup.

Shake vigorously for 15-20 seconds to chill and mix the ingredients.

Step 3: Serve

- Fill the prepared margarita glass with fresh ice cubes.
- Strain the cocktail from the cocktail shaker into the glass.
- Garnish with a lime wedge for a classic touch.
Step 4: Optional Mango Variation

For a tropical flair, add 2 oz mango puree to the cocktail shaker before shaking. For a frozen version, blend all ingredients with 1 cup of ice in a blender until smooth.

Tips for the Perfect Margarita
- Choose Quality Tequila: A good tequila makes all the difference. Blanco tequila gives a crisp, clean flavor, while reposado adds a smoother, slightly oaky taste.
- Fresh is Best: Always use freshly squeezed lime juice for a vibrant, authentic taste.
- Adjust Sweetness: If you prefer a less sweet margarita, reduce the simple syrup to 0.5 oz or skip it entirely.
- Play with Rims: Experiment with chili salt or a sugar rim for variety.

Variations to Try

The margarita is endlessly adaptable. Here are some fun twists:
- Mango Margarita: Add mango puree for a tropical vibe, as mentioned above.
- Spicy Margarita: Muddle a few slices of jalapeño in the cocktail shaker before adding the other ingredients.
- Frozen Strawberry Margarita: Blend with 1 cup frozen strawberries for a slushy, fruity twist.
- Skinny Margarita: Skip simple syrup and add a splash of orange juice for fewer calories.

Frequently Asked Questions About Margaritas Cocktail
1. Can I make a margarita without a cocktail shaker?
Yes, you can mix the ingredients in a pitcher with a spoon, but a cocktail shaker ensures a well-chilled and blended drink.
2. What’s the best tequila for a margarita?
Blanco tequila offers a crisp, clean flavor, while reposado adds a smoother, slightly oaky taste. Choose a high-quality brand for the best results.
